Mack 1877 er produsert med ren pilsnermalt og klassisk, tsjekkisk Saazer humle. Ølet har en markert, men behagelig bitterhet og en forfriskende krydret humlearoma.

500 ml can. A clear, pale golden body with a white head. Aroma is slightly perfumed and have some flower. Mild malty flavor, malty sweetness, some bitterness and floral hops. Medium body and some more obvious bitterness in the aftertaste. All in all a pretty ordinary lager, decent but nothing to search for.

50cl can from Varnaveien mineralvann. Pours clear pale golden with a white head. Lightly malty aroma with some fruity and lightly hoppy notes. Hints vegetables and metal too. Quite sweet , almost a bit honey like with som floral hints and a light, but pleasant bitterness in the finish. Slightly better than the usual pale lagers, but still quite far from a decent Bohemian Pilsener.

Golden colour with a fine big white head. Leaves a fine lacing. Fresh caramel malt aroma. Moderate sweetness and an ok moderate bitterness. Soft carbonation. Mild caramel malt flavour.
